Mesothelioma Settlement Payouts
Many mesothelioma cases settle before trial. Settlements offer a guarantee of compensation - rather than the possibility of losing and not receive any compensation at trial, or even win and receive a low amount.
In settlement negotiations, attorneys take into consideration a variety of factors. This article will examine some of those aspects that affect a victim's settlement.
Damages Amount
Compensation is accessible to a lot of victims of mesothelioma or asbestos-related diseases. Compensation may cover medical expenses loss of income, as well as other damages. A mesothelioma lawyer will help victims understand the types of damages that they may be awarded and the IRS rules will apply to compensation.
diffuse mesothelioma payment lawsuits are complicated and time-consuming, but they can provide victims with much needed financial relief. The money from a mesothelioma settlement can help victims and their families pay for essential living expenses, such as medical care and housing. It can also ensure that loved ones will be taken care of in the event that the patient is unable to work or earn a living.
Asbestos lawyers can assist victims receive the compensation they are entitled to from a mesothelioma suit. They will examine the employment history of the victim to determine the companies that are responsible for their exposure to asbestos. After the attorneys have identified liable companies, they will begin the process of discovery to discover evidence for a trial.
The jury will determine how much compensation victims should receive after a mesothelioma verdict is reached. The amount will include non-compensatory damages, such as punitive damages, which punish the defendant company for the harms it caused. The amount will also include compensatory damages that pay victims for losses.
The value of a mesothelioma lawsuit can vary significantly, depending on a number of factors, including the severity of the cancer as well as how it was contracted. Families and victims should seek out the guidance of skilled lawyers to construct an effective case.
The compensation from a lawsuit for mesothelioma payment can also be used to obtain the most effective treatment available. It is also possible to obtain benefits for veterans wounded vets who have been exposed to asbestos in the military, and who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ma.
Compensation from mesothelioma settlements is generally tax-free, with the exception of non-compensatory damages like punitive awards. A mesothelioma attorney can help clients understand the tax implications of their settlement and how to file taxes.
Time Period
In addition to financial compensation for medical costs as well as loss of income and pain and suffering mesothelioma settlements can include punitive damages that are intended to punish the companies responsible for asbestos exposure. The typical timeframe for mesothelioma lawsuit settlements is one year. However, it can take longer when the victims have filed claims against multiple asbestos companies or manufacturers who have refused to participate in settlement negotiations.
When it comes to mesothelioma cases it can be challenging to receive the amount you deserve due to the fact that these cases usually require long legal processes and a lot of research. You should select a law firm that has expertise in filing these kinds of lawsuits and has a track record of obtaining fair settlement offers.
The statute of limitations for mesothelioma lawsuits could also affect the amount you get. These laws vary from state to state and, based on your specific situation, you should consult with an attorney as soon as you can.
The symptoms of mesothelioma can appear years or even decades after exposure to asbestos, which can complicate a case. It is therefore important to have an attorney who has experience in these cases, and Mesothelioma Settlement Payouts knows how to locate the evidence you require.
The severity of the diagnosis is a different aspect that influences mesothelioma compensation payouts. Mesothelioma and asbestos lung cancer are severe illnesses that can quickly decrease life expectancy. This is why it is essential to seek out the best treatment available to help prolong your life and keep your symptoms manageable.
Settlements for asbestos lawsuits can provide financial relief for victims and their loved ones when the condition becomes too severe to treat. Asbestos companies typically settle quickly because they do not want to go to trial and risk a substantial verdict.
The amount of mesothelioma lawsuit payouts will vary based on various factors including the severity of the disease and the kind of asbestos exposure, and the length of time the victim was exposed to it. In certain cases, the jury award could be reversed or lowered by a judge or a deal between the parties following trial.
Expenses
The compensation that mesothelioma victims receive can be used to cover medical expenses as well as lost income and living expenses. They also have the opportunity to live life to the fullest, and provides the right to restitution for their loved relatives.
The amount of compensation a victim is determined by a variety of factors, including the location of their residence and the length of their exposure. The asbestos-related victims who have had the most extensive exposure are often awarded higher settlements than those with less exposure histories. The severity of the disease is also a factor in the amount of the settlement.
The cost of mesothelioma treatment can add up quickly. Asbestos sufferers must undergo a myriad of tests and treatments to ensure that they are receiving the best possible treatment. This can require travel expenses to top mesothelioma specialists and home health aides and assistive equipment to assist patients get through their daily routine.
Asbestos-related victims may also be eligible for disability compensation from the VA to cover these expenses and other financial losses. In reality, veterans account for about 30% of mesothelioma patients. The VA has created a number of initiatives to aid these individuals.
In addition to the financial assistance provided by an asbestos settlement or trial verdict, the affected veterans also can receive monthly compensation as well as other disability benefits from the VA. Asbestos victims can even use the funds to fund diffuse mesothelioma payments treatment through home-based or travel-based rehabilitative treatments.
A mesothelioma lawsuit is a method of holding companies accountable for their injuries. In pre-trial discovery, lawyers may uncover evidence of corporate deceit and negligent actions that caused asbestos exposure.
The very rare occasions when mesothelioma lawsuits do not settle without court proceedings can result in a trial which can result in significant jury award to victims. However, trials are more costly and time-consuming than asbestos settlements. The majority of victims settle their mesothelioma cases rather than going to trial. A knowledgeable lawyer can assist clients in reaching the most favorable settlement terms.
Representation
A mesothelioma deal is a contract between the victims or their families, as well as defendants like asbestos companies. This type of lawsuit resolves a case without going to trial and involves a number of financial compensation awards. Compensation can include reimbursements for medical expenses as well as loss of income, pain and suffering, and other damages. mesothelioma settlement payments attorneys represent clients throughout the settlement process, including negotiations with the at-fault company.
Attorneys can also make sure that the settlement is reflected in the full extent of a victim's losses. They will consider a variety of factors, including a person's age and health when determining the amount of compensation they will give. They will also look at the location and how exposure to asbestos occurred. The history of the victim's employment is important, as it will show how long the asbestos exposure lasted, as well as what type of job they held.
Mesothelioma lawyers can determine a fair amount of settlement by looking at the facts of each case and assessing the obligations of the asbestos manufacturers at fault. The size of a settlement usually depends on the duration of exposure and how much money the victim has paid or is likely to spend on treatment. Defendants' legal and insurance status could affect the final settlement figure.
In the face of high medical expenses, patients and their families may find it difficult to focus on mesothelioma treatments. They are often unable earn money while focusing on mesothelioma payout treatment and caregiving. They are often in debt and miss out on the opportunity to plan their future financial needs. The compensation from a mesothelioma settlement can ease or eliminate these burdens.
Attorneys who specialize on mesothelioma have the expertise to manage this difficult litigation. They will provide an honest assessment of the value of the case and help families of victims to negotiate an acceptable settlement. They will also develop an effective legal strategy to negotiate the most lucrative compensation amount.
